เนื้อหา
เมื่อคุณแชร์ฐานข้อมูล Access 2007 กับผู้อื่นคุณจะต้องจัดเตรียมมาตรการรักษาความปลอดภัยเพื่อให้มั่นใจในการปกป้องข้อมูลและวัตถุที่อยู่ด้านหลัง สิ่งนี้จะมีประโยชน์จริง ๆ เมื่อวางไว้บนเซิร์ฟเวอร์ที่คอมพิวเตอร์หลายเครื่องสามารถเข้าถึงได้ในเวลาเดียวกัน คุณสามารถจัดทำแพคเกจฐานข้อมูล Access เพื่อให้ปรากฏเป็นแอปพลิเคชันแบบสแตนด์อะโลนดังนั้นซ่อนตารางรายงานแบบสอบถามฟอร์มแมโครและโมดูลโค้ดเพื่อไม่ให้บุคคลที่ไม่ได้รับอนุญาตเข้าถึงได้
คำสั่ง
วิธีแปลง Access 2007 เป็นโหมดปฏิบัติการเพื่อให้ผู้ใช้รายอื่นไม่เห็นฐานข้อมูลของฉัน (Jupiterimages / Creatas / Getty Images)-
เปิดฐานข้อมูลของคุณใน Access 2007
-
คลิกปุ่ม "มาโคร" แท็บ "มาโครและรหัส" ในแท็บ "สร้าง"
-
พิมพ์ "LockNavigationPane" ในกล่อง "เพิ่มการกระทำใหม่" เมื่อช่อง "ล็อค" ปรากฏขึ้นให้เลือก "ไม่" คลิกที่เครื่องหมาย "+" เพื่อเพิ่มฟิลด์ใหม่ ป้อน "SetDisplayedCategories" ตั้งค่าฟิลด์ "แสดง" เป็น "ไม่" และ "หมวดหมู่" เป็น "ประเภทวัตถุ"
-
คลิกที่เครื่องหมาย "+" เพื่อเพิ่มฟิลด์ใหม่ ป้อน "SetDisplayedCategories" ตั้งค่าฟิลด์ "แสดง" เป็น "ไม่" และ "หมวดหมู่" เป็น "ตารางและมุมมองที่เกี่ยวข้อง" เพิ่มฟิลด์ใหม่และพิมพ์ "LockNavigationPane" ตั้งค่า "ล็อค" เป็น "ใช่" คลิกไอคอน "บันทึก" บนแท็บ "หน้าแรก" เพื่อบันทึกแมโครเป็น "AutoExec" การเข้าถึงจะเรียกใช้แมโครนี้โดยอัตโนมัติในครั้งถัดไปที่เปิดฐานข้อมูลตราบใดที่มีชื่อว่า "AutoExec" ตอนนี้สิ่งที่คุณต้องทำคือจัดทำแพคเกจฐานข้อมูลเพื่อให้สามารถใช้งานได้
-
คลิกปุ่ม "Office", "Publish" จากนั้นเลือก "Package and Sign" เลือกใบรับรองความปลอดภัยดิจิทัลที่คุณต้องการใช้และคลิก "ไม่" เลือกที่ตั้งที่จะบันทึกเมื่อกล่องโต้ตอบ "สร้างแพคเกจที่ลงชื่อ Microsoft Access" ปรากฏขึ้นภายใต้ "บันทึกใน" ป้อนชื่อสำหรับฐานข้อมูลที่สามารถเรียกใช้งานได้ในฟิลด์ "ชื่อไฟล์" คลิก "สร้าง" Access จะทำแพคเกจฐานข้อมูลและบันทึกด้วยรูปแบบไฟล์ ".accdc" เมื่อเรียกใช้มันจะทำหน้าที่เป็นแอปพลิเคชันแบบสแตนด์อโลนและผู้ใช้จะต้องยอมรับใบรับรองความปลอดภัยเพื่อเรียกใช้ วัตถุฐานข้อมูลและบานหน้าต่างนำทางทั้งหมดจะถูกซ่อนจากมุมมองของคุณ